Athena Kontonikolaki is a ceramic artist whose practice explores the expressive tension between function and abstraction. Her work navigates the space where utilitarian forms meet sculptural presence, inviting a dialogue between the everyday and the poetic. Grounded in a hands-on approach, she works across hand-building, wheel-throwing, glaze development, and firing experimentation. Embracing the trial-and-error nature intrinsic to ceramics, Athena engages with form, surface, and concept through iterative play.
